Libius Severus (Latin: Flavius Libius Severus Serpentius Augustus[1][2]) (Lucania, c. 420 – 15 August 465), also Severus III,[3] was Western Roman Emperor from November 19, 461 to his death.

A Roman senator from Lucania[4] Severus was one of the last Western emperors, emptied of any effective power (the real power was in the hands of the magister militum Ricimer), and unable to solve the many problems affecting the empire; the sources describe him as a pious Christian.[5]
